Salvage Pirates: Rabaul and the Hakkai Maru Treasure

This book is a gripping tale of an Australian salvage pirate and his audacious plan to recover the treasure from the Hakkai Maru. This Japanese refinery ship roamed the Pacific during WW2, rendering down illegally plundered precious metals. The salvage was fraught with danger. The shipwreck was deep, and the diving equipment primitive. There was a constant risk of nitrogen narcosis (the bends) and the ever-present threat of sharks. This remarkable book chronicles the penetration deep into the dark recesses of the sunken ship, where copper wire dangled like spider webs, waiting to snare the unwary diver. Live and unstable munitions littered the ship, ready to explode at a touch. But, along the way, there was to be fun, steamy romance, and adventure, all coupled with tragedy, death, and unforeseen complications. This is a compelling, must-read novel based on historical fact and written in a documentary style. Set in the romantic South Pacific in 1970, the tale is fullof twists and turns, and the ending, despair for the skipper.
